Transaction 7c42146899b3c608f028587f428eec4ebb5e752a8dd0181938867b272d61a69a
1 Input
1 Output
-
7c42146899b3c608f028587f428eec4ebb5e752a8dd0181938867b272d61a69a:0
- value
- 15105647
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03c51cc85653442ab7948b0dab2a0f4b9fbe5839 OP_EQUAL
- address
- 322x5jMikhV1dj19wWPJR6YevZLLVih2BG